Definition of Karat in Gold:

In the context of gold, the term “karat” refers to the purity of the metal. Pure gold is designated as 24 karats (24k), meaning it is composed entirely of gold without any other alloy metals. However, pure gold is too soft for practical use in jewelry or other applications. Therefore, gold is often alloyed with other metals to enhance its durability and strength. The karat system is used to denote the proportion of gold in an alloy, with 24k representing pure gold and lower karat values indicating a lower percentage of gold content.

Comparison of 22k and 916 Gold:

22k gold and 916 gold are essentially the same, both indicating a gold purity of 91.6%. The term “22k” denotes that the gold alloy contains 22 parts gold and 2 parts other metals, while “916” signifies that the gold comprises 91.6% of the total metal content, with the remaining 8.4% consisting of alloying metals such as silver, copper, or zinc. This gold alloy is renowned for its rich color, luster, and durability, making it a popular choice for jewelry and investment purposes.

Usage and Durability:

Despite its high gold content, 22k/916 gold is relatively soft compared to lower karat alloys. As a result, it is not typically used for intricate or delicate jewelry designs that require intricate detailing or structural integrity. Instead, 22k/916 gold is commonly used for traditional, statement pieces such as bangles, necklaces, and earrings, where its rich color and substantial weight are prized.

Certification and Hallmarks:

In India, the hallmarking of gold jewelry is governed by the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S), which ensures that gold products meet specified purity standards. The BIS 916 hallmark certifies that the gold alloy contains 91.6% pure gold, providing consumers with assurance of authenticity and quality. When purchasing 22k/916 gold jewelry, it is essential to look for the BIS hallmark as a guarantee of purity and compliance with regulatory standards.

Care and Maintenance:

To preserve the luster and shape of 22k/916 gold jewelry, regular maintenance and care are essential. Avoid exposing gold jewelry to harsh chemicals, perfumes, or cosmetics, as these can tarnish the metal and dull its shine. When not in use, store gold jewelry in a soft pouch or cloth to prevent scratches and abrasions. Periodic cleaning with a mild soap solution and gentle polishing can help restore the brilliance of 22k/916 gold jewelry, ensuring it maintains its beauty for years to come.
